LinkedMusicians started the topic HoRNet Multicomp Plus MK2v 90% Off €4.99 for 48HRS w/Code in the forum Virtual & Physical Music Gear Deals
Use the code MCP29026 at checkout to bring the price down from €49.90 to €4.99.
Features
Five compression models (VCA, FET, OPTO, Console4K, VCA160) and one expander.
Auto make up gain algorithm.
Auto threshold to desired gain reduction
Analog emulation based on AnalogStage
Adjustable analog emulation level
